Likewise, in San Francisco Ixtacamaxtitlan, there are the remains of the Chapel of the Santiago District, dedicated to the Apostle Santiago, founded in the 16th century. Its façade is plateresque with its rose window, characteristic of 16th century architecture. Oriented towards the west, its roof was originally a gabled tile roof, but it no longer has one today.

Municipality

Ixtacamaxtitlán is a Mexican municipality located in the north of the state of Puebla, within the northern mountains of Puebla, the main architectural construction is the Parish Church dedicated to San Francisco de Asís dating from the 16th century, located in the municipal seat, as well as a great variety of objects and monoliths from the pre-Columbian era, it also has a local museum of the pre-Columbian era, its main festival is celebrated on October 4 in honor of Saint Francis of Assisi with dances, processions, fireworks and a fair.
